    Im sure we have all pushed the limits of normality at some point in our lives in order to get our game on, for instance;

    During school holidays one year, I was 12 years old and had no money but was obsessed with the arcades. I found a R5 coin in the house and knew that tokens at the time were R2ea but the nearest arcade was the other side of town. I figured I had a whole day of nothing ahead of me so I may as well walk. I freakin walked across town bought 2 tokens and proceeded to lose them both on the first level of Aliens vs Predator. 2 hours walk for 15 minutes of game time, then 2 hours walk back home bummed as heck! hahaha!

    I remember way back when I was still at school, I was playing Flight Simulator 95 quite a lot. One day I took a protractor, pencil and ruler to one of our atlases at home to plot a flight path from San Francisco to Los Angeles. I was way too little to do it properly, but I got the bearings and headings. So the next day (it was a Saturday) I woke up very early to do the flight. In my mind, I played as if it was an early flight. I was training my landing skills with the jet for about a week, so on the day I started the journey, plotted my course, and flew the route. I got a bit lost but managed to find the correct airport. I concentrated so hard and at the end landed the plane safely on the ground. It is probably one of my proudest moments while playing a game, and the most work I've ever put into playing a game.

    I remember riding my bike to the store in the rain to buy an Atari Lynx. It was a 10-15 minute drive by car, mostly 80km/h. My dad was going to give me a ride when he got home from work, but I was too excited. I got home and got to play for a little bit, but the only batteries I had died in no time. My dad got home about an hour after I did...

    I wasn't able to use it for 2 days until I was able to go get an AC adapter from a different store...
